Definitions:

Somatic Pain

Discomfort that arises from ligaments, tendons, bones, blood vessels, and nerves.

Sprained Ankle

An injury involving the stretching or tearing of ligaments around the ankle, often caused by twisting or rolling the foot.

Medical Diagnosis

A diagnosis that refers to disease processes—specific pathophysiological responses that are fairly uniform from one client to another.

Central Sensitization

Prolonged firing of nociceptors with severe and persistent injury, such as surgery, causes dorsal horn spinal cord neurons to become more responsive to all inputs.
